Title
TOTOLINK A7100RU命令注入漏洞(CNVD-2026-36552)
Description
TOTOLINK A7100RU是吉翁电子(深圳)有限公司(TOTOLINK品牌)生产的一款双频千兆无线路由器。
TOTOLINK A7100RU存在命令注入漏洞,该漏洞源于setting/delStaticDhcpRules存在通过city参数的命令注入漏洞。攻击者可利用该漏洞执行任意命令。
Severity
高
